Korea Institute of Toxicology Gyeongnam Branch Institute was founded in 2012 under the purpose of resolving difficulty of domestic chemical industry in accordance with reinforcement of international environmental regulation and enhance the support to new medicine development. Gyeongnam Branch Institute is a regional-hub local organization specializing in environmental toxicology, and built GLP system in the field of environmental risk test first in Korea.
Especially, we play the role of supporting domestic chemical business to respond to domestic and overseas chemical regulation such as ARECS(Act on registration and evaluation, etc. of chemical substances) and EU-REACH(Chemical regulation system in EU).
Gyeongnam Branch Institute conducts integrated research on risk and hazard assessment research in accordance with chemical exposure in the facilities such as Ecotoxicology Laboratory building and Environmental Risk Assessment Research building. Also, we obtained GLP certificate for agricultural pesticide residue test, and conduct metabolic test on soil and crops using radioactive isotope.
